DISASSEMBLY
WARNING
· Remove rings, bracelets, wristwatches,
and neck chains before working around
the locomotive. Jewelry can catch on
equipment and cause injury, or may
short across an electrical circuit and
cause severe burns or electrical shock.
· High voltage is used in the operation of
equipment. Do not be misled by the
term LOW VOLTAGE. Potentials as
low as 50 volts may cause death.
NOTE
When the sander control valve is
completely disassembled, a repair kit
should be install. Refer to TM 55-2210-
224-24P for the correct repair kit.
1.
Remove gasket (1) from valve body (2). Retain
gasket.
2.
Remove O-ring (3) and strainer plug (4). Discard
O-ring.
3.
Remove spring cap (5) and spring (6).
4.
Remove valve assembly (7).
5.
Remove locknut (8), seat washer (9), and
neoprene valve seat (10) from valve stem (11).
Discard valve seat.
